八股文 八股 编译器array

反编译引擎和后端代码分析

Reko不仅包含核心反编译引擎和后端代码分析模块,而且还提供了用户友好的操作界面。目前,该工具提供了Windows GUI和ASP.NET后端。反编译引擎需要从前端获取用户的输入,可接受的输入为单独的可执行文件或反编译项目文件。Reko项目文件中还包含了代码文件的额外信息,来为研究人员的反编译操作或 ......
代码 引擎

qgc 编译运行

实际是吐槽,并不是教程 wsl2上 qt编译安装过程按照某博客来的基本没什么问题 编译安装源码后发现少组件,安装了两个之后,剩下的github里没找到,没法编译安装,而且没有Maintenance,最后charts和texttospeech没法处理放弃了 windows上 呃,一开始版本不对,qgc ......
qgc

LNMP架构的源码编译

一、编译安装Nginx 1关闭防火墙 systemctl stop firewalld systemctl disable firewalld setenforce 0 2 安装依赖包 yum -y install pcre-devel zlib-devel gcc gcc-c++ make 3 创 ......
架构 源码 LNMP

Oracle 批量编译对象

Oracle 在导入数据时,往往会造成存储过程、触发器、视图、函数等对象失效,如果数量比较多,单个编译起来比较麻烦,这里介绍一种批量编译的方法: 查询对象 select * from all_objects 通过上面的查询结果,可以看到当前数据库的对象类型(索引、存储过程、表、视图、函数等)和状态( ......
对象 Oracle

ERROR Failed to compile with 541 errors 11:27:44 These dependencies were not found: * core-js/modules/es.array.concat.js in ./node_modules/cache-loader/dist/cjs.js??ref--12-0!./

ERROR Failed to compile with 541 errors 11:27:44 These dependencies were not found: * core-js/modules/es.array.concat.js in ./node_modules/cache-loade ......

Java 在代码中区分json和array

public static void main(String[] args){ String n ="{\n" + " "data": [\n" + " {\n" + " "category": "设计资质",\n" + " "certNameList": [\n" + " {\n" + " "ce ......
中区 代码 array Java json

大型typescript项目优化webpack编译速度

Person: A large typescript project takes a long time to start every time, using the default configuration of webpack5, is there any optimization solut ......
typescript 速度 webpack 项目

编译完linux内核后指定内核模块安装路径

使用 make modules_install INSTALL_MOD_PATH=<路径> , 如,$ make modules_install INSTALL_MOD_PATH=/home/jello/kernel_modules ......
内核 路径 模块 linux

xformers-0.0.11版本在mac下的编译

xFormers是一个模块化和可编程的Transformer建模库;相关介绍可以查看官方文档: https://facebookresearch.github.io/xformers/; 由于电脑硬件过于古老,需要使用到xformers的更老的版本,这里是0.0.11版本,这是使用torch==1. ......
xformers 版本 mac 11

Vue2模版编译(AST、Optimize 、Render)

在Vue $mount过程中,我们需要把模版编译成render函数,整体实现可以分为三部分: parse、optimize、codegen。 ......
模版 Optimize Render Vue2 Vue

三天吃透MySQL面试八股文

本文已经收录到Github仓库,该仓库包含计算机基础、Java基础、多线程、JVM、数据库、Redis、Spring、Mybatis、SpringMVC、SpringBoot、分布式、微服务、设计模式、架构、校招社招分享等核心知识点,欢迎star~ Github地址:https://github.c ......
八股文 八股 MySQL

cmake编译报错 undefined reference to `xxx'

错误信息:F:/github/Demos/br_cmake_proj/Demos/CmakeProject2/main.cpp:11: undefined reference to `Module1A::Module1A()' 代码目录结构 相关代码片段 错误根因:模块.cmake中对SOURCES ......
undefined reference cmake xxx 39

IDEA编译输出目录Compiler Output的设置

idea 项目整体Project 编译输出目录设置 File ——> Project Structure ——> Project ——> Compiler Output 填写内容: 项目路径\out idea 项目模块Module 编译输出目录设置 File ——> Project Structur ......
Compiler 目录 Output IDEA

Qt 5.13 编译 qtopcua 源码

编译环境 Windows 10 Qt 5.13.2 MinGW 7.3.0 编译 (1)编译前,请先确保本机已安装了 Perl。 下载地址:Strawberry Perl for Windows (2)点击屏幕左下角的 Windows 图标,在打开的开始菜单栏中,找到 Qt 5.13.2 目录,启动 ......
源码 qtopcua 5.13 Qt 13

linux编译加密版sqlite

加密版SQLite3MultipleCiphers下载网址: https://github.com/utelle/SQLite3MultipleCiphers/ 下载解压后,在终端执行以下2行命令就能生成libsqlite3.so,建议将libsqlite3.so拷贝到工程的文件夹。 cd srcg ......
sqlite linux

算法API--Arrays

二分查找方法的细节1:数组中的元素必须是有序的,并且是升序的 二分查找方法的细节2: 拷贝数组的方法细节: sort按照指定规则排序的底层原理:这里需要二分查找和插入排序,匿名内部类的知识 代码实现: import java.util.Arrays;import java.util.Comparat ......
算法 Arrays API

程序员的自我修养-编译链接

常见场景 你是在工作中遇到如下问题或者疑问: undefined reference to “function”。链接过程中出现未定义引用。 .a和.so文件分别是什么?什么情况下使用? extern "C"有什么作用? 等等... 编译过程 我们平时编译,如果没有加任何编译参数将默认执行预处理,编 ......
程序员 修养 链接 程序

numpy.ndarray.flatten-返回array一维的复制本

参考:https://numpy.org/doc/stable/reference/generated/numpy.ndarray.flatten.html 语法格式 ndarray.flatten(order='C') 参数order有{"C", "F', "A", "K"}可供选择。C '表示按 ......
ndarray flatten numpy array

三天吃透Spring面试八股文

本文已经收录到Github仓库,该仓库包含计算机基础、Java基础、多线程、JVM、数据库、Redis、Spring、Mybatis、SpringMVC、SpringBoot、分布式、微服务、设计模式、架构、校招社招分享等核心知识点,欢迎star~ Github地址 Spring的优点 通过控制反转 ......
八股文 八股 Spring

面试高频问题之C++编译过程

C++编译过程 C++是一种高级编程语言,但是计算机并不能直接理解它。因此,需要将C++代码翻译成计算机可以理解的机器语言。这个过程就是编译过程,是C++程序从源代码到可执行文件的转换过程,包括预处理、编译、汇编和链接四个阶段。 1. 预处理 在编译器开始编译之前,会先进行预处理。预处理器会处理代码 ......
过程 问题

《渗透测试》WEB攻防-Python考点&CTF与CMS-SSTI模版注入&PYC反编译 2022 Day23

1 1 PY反编译-PYC编译文件反编译源码 1.1 pyc文件是py文件编译后生成的字节码文件(byte code),pyc文件经过python解释器最终会生成机器码运行。因此pyc文件是可以跨平台部署的,类似Java的.class文件,一般py文件改变后,都会重新生成pyc文件。 真题附件:ht ......
考点 模版 amp CMS-SSTI Python

c++ linux 编译 静态库 ,动态库

一起编译: 静态路径 要用全路径 静态编译 规范写法 ......
静态 动态 linux

linux c++编译

gcc -v 查看版本 指定 名字 多文件编译 ......
linux

java: Arrays sort

package Dal; /** *整数数组 * @author geovindu * @version 1.0 */ public class NumberAssociative { /** *只显示数组 * @param arr 输入数组 整数数组 * @return 返回 要显示的整数数组 * ......
Arrays java sort

gcc g++ 动态库,静态库的编译

首先 来看看静态库: 总体的说明: 怎么创建静态库: 网上的截图如下; 怎么使用静态库: 静态库 在使用的时候, 直接./ 就可以了。 动态库在执行的时候 还要加上别的参数,做指明。这里写错了, 动态库的执行 也是 ./main 这种方式。 静态库 在制作可执行文件的时候, 是将库一起加到 可执行文 ......
静态 动态 gcc

MLIR基本理论,IR表示和编译器框架

MLIR基本理论,IR表示和编译器框架 MLIR:重要术语、概念 MLIR glossary 参考资料 [1] MLIR:Glossary: https://mlir.llvm.org/getting_started/Glossary/ [2] Block: https://mlir.llvm.or ......
编译器 框架 理论 MLIR

centos 7 手动编译升级gcc9.3.0

1、下载gcc9.3.0源码包 wget https://mirrors.tuna.tsinghua.edu.cn/gnu/gcc/gcc-9.3.0/gcc-9.3.0.tar.gz sudo tar xvf gcc-9.3.0.tar.gz ./contrib/download_prerequi ......
手动 centos gcc9 3.0 gcc

centos7 yum 安装nodejs 16,搭建编译vue项目环境

1、安装nodejs curl -fsSL https://rpm.nodesource.com/setup_16.x | sudo bash - sudo yum install nodejs node -v 2、安装yarn #安装yarn npm install -g yarn #查看版本 y ......
centos7 环境 项目 centos nodejs

buildroot 在编译的时候的 大小端的选择

首先来看一下 网上关于大小端的解释 那么 我在 编译龙芯 mips 的 buildroot ,该怎么选择 大小端呢, 要去看 pmon 中的解释: ......
buildroot 大小 端的 时候

3 - 进程 - Windows 10 - Cpython - 多进程通信 - 队列Queue _ 管道Pipe _ 共享内存Share Memory(Value_Array) _ Manager

@(目录) 测试环境: 操作系统: Window 10 工具:Pycharm Python: 3.7 一、进程通信概述: python的进程间通信主要有以下几种方式:消息队列(Queue)、管道(Pipe)、共享内存(Value,Array)、代理(Manager)。 以上分为两个类型, 进程间交互 ......
进程 队列 Value_Array 管道 内存